Transaction 61f496f02e6c005fd957d3122151473c992c2bd66bdde5bb6986af9670a517b9

1 Input
2 Outputs
  • 61f496f02e6c005fd957d3122151473c992c2bd66bdde5bb6986af9670a517b9:0
  • value  25000
    address  31mSE9n7Q9QrSh5dsqbYqfsoaujcSdf9WS
  • 61f496f02e6c005fd957d3122151473c992c2bd66bdde5bb6986af9670a517b9:1
  • value  6679764
    address  3CfphkWxrUnmPCGdZSLvbY1hmQ536m18rr